Job Purpose



The Senior Resident Doctor/Senior Registrar will provide advanced medical care under the supervision of consultants and resident doctors, focusing on specialized cases and supporting junior residents and interns. This role includes hands-on patient care, diagnostics, and participation in ongoing education and clinical research to foster professional growth and maintain high standards of medical practice.



Core Responsibilities



Clinical Expertise in Cardiovascular Care




  • Lead patient assessments, including medical history, physical examination, and interpretation of diagnostic tests (e.g., ECG, echocardiogram).

  • Independently diagnose and manage a wide range of cardiovascular diseases, including complex cases of hypertension, heart failure, arrhythmias, coronary artery disease, and valvular heart diseases.

  • Develop and implement comprehensive treatment regimens, including medication, lifestyle changes, and interventional therapies.

  • Supervise and guide junior colleagues in the emergency management of cardiovascular conditions, such as myocardial infarction and stroke.



Theatre Assistance and Surgical Support




  • Lead preoperative assessments, including preparing patients for surgery and ensuring appropriate anaesthesia protocols.

  • Expertly support the cardiology team during complex cardiovascular procedures, such as heart surgeries, catheterization, and angioplasty.

  • Oversee the proper sterilization and handling of surgical equipment and instruments in the theatre.

  • Supervise the monitoring of patients under anaesthesia and assist in managing complex intraoperative complications.

  • Lead post-operative care, including pain management, monitoring for complications, and patient education.



Emergency Care and Response




  • Expertly and rapidly evaluate patients to determine the severity of the condition to prioritize care, allocate resources, and ensure timely interventions.

  • Confidently perform life-saving procedures (e.g., CPR, intubation) to stabilize critically ill patients and prevent further deterioration.

  • Independently order and interpret diagnostic tests (e.g., labs, imaging) to quickly identify underlying conditions and guide treatment.

  • Expertly manage shock, trauma, or medical emergencies to restore vital functions, prevent organ failure, and optimize patient outcomes.

  • Lead emergency teams and provide clear handover to ensure seamless transitions, prevent errors, and maintain continuity of care.

  • Mentor junior team members in interpreting lab results, imaging, and other diagnostic tools.



Clinical Audits and Compliance




  • Ensure adherence to AMCE and regulatory standards for clinical practice, including infection control, safety, and medical ethics.

  • Lead clinical audits, quality improvement initiatives, and departmental meetings to improve patient care.

  • Oversee the maintenance of accurate patient records, adhering to documentation and confidentiality standards as outlined by the Medical and Dental Council of Nigeria (MDCN).



Patient Care and Advocacy




  • Develop and deliver comprehensive patient and family education programs on cardiovascular conditions, treatment options, post-operative care, and preventive measures.

  • Provide exemplary compassionate and holistic care to patients, addressing both physical and emotional needs during their treatment journey.

  • Act as a strong advocate for patients, ensuring they receive timely and appropriate care while respecting their cultural, emotional, and psychological needs.



Leadership and Supervision




  • Provide expert supervision and mentorship to junior doctors and medical students during rounds, assisting with clinical decision-making and patient management.

  • Lead case discussions and contribute to complex clinical decision-making in both the cardiovascular and surgical settings.

  • Effectively lead and coordinate the multidisciplinary team, including cardiologists, cardiovascular surgeons, anaesthetists, and nurses.



Training and Professional Development




  • Maintain expert-level knowledge of cardiovascular medicine, surgery, and related fields through continuous learning and development.

  • Actively participate in and lead ongoing educational opportunities, including seminars, workshops, and clinical teaching sessions.

  • Lead and contribute to AMCE clinical research activities, including studies on new treatments, procedures, or technologies in cardiovascular care and surgery.



Qualifications



Educational Requirements




  • Medical Degree (MBBS, MBChB or its equivalent) from a recognised Institution.

  • Completion of Residency program

  • Pass in the Primary Fellowship Examination of the National Postgraduate Medical College of Nigeria (NPMCN) or its equivalent in the relevant specialty within the past 4 years.



Professional Requirements




  • Valid medical license in the country of practice

  • Membership in relevant medical associations, such as the Nigerian Cardiac Society (NCS), the Society of Family Physicians of Nigeria (SOFPON or other cardiology associations or its equivalent



Experience Requirements




  • Minimum of 4 years of clinical experience as a resident doctor in a hospital setting, preferably with experience in cardiology or surgery.

  • Experience in performing surgeries, particularly cardiovascular procedures, and managing patients in critical care units.

  • Familiarity with operating theatre protocols, patient monitoring, and post-operative care.



Knowledge Requirements




  • In-depth knowledge of cardiology, including cardiac anatomy, pathophysiology, and treatment protocols.

  • Proficiency in interpreting and conducting diagnostic procedures like ECGs, echocardiograms, and cardiac catheterizations.

  • Familiarity with the management of cardiac emergencies and post-operative care for cardiac patients.

  • Awareness of clinical guidelines and protocols established by national and international cardiology organizations.
